  • Today's podcast guest is the remarkable Doctor Cudkowicz, a neurologist and neuroscientist renowned for her work on amyotrophic lateral sclerosis (ALS). A Julieanne Dorn Professor of Neurology at Harvard Medical School and director of the Sean Healey ALS clinic at Massachusetts General Hospital, Merit has been pivotal in leading collaborative research and clinical trials for ALS. With an impressive academic journey from MIT to Harvard, her passion for neuroscience and patient care is evident. Merit's work brings hope to countless individuals affected by this condition.     Tim Green's "Nothing Left Unsaid" is a weekly podcast hosted by Tim and Troy Green. Tim is a former first round NFL draft pick, member of the College Football Hall of Fame, New York Times #1 Bestselling Author, former Fox broadcaster, NPR contributor, family man, ALS advocate, and so much more.
    Each week, Tim and Troy will sit down with interesting people to have thoughtful conversations. The guests will range from celebrities, athletes, academics, doctors, authors, and more. As Tim battles his ALS diagnosis, nothing is out of bounds and there will be nothing left unsaid.
